#!/bin/bash
# services/pstn-trunk.sh — SIP PSTN trunk add-on for asterisk-digital-ocean:
# US-only outbound (NANP dialplan restriction), a configurable concurrent-call
# cap, role-based outbound permission (some extensions internal-only, some
# PSTN-enabled), a configurable inbound ring-group, IP-authenticated trunk
# (no SIP password stored), ntfy alerts on denied/rejected calls, and a
# periodic spend/volume check.
#
# Defaults to VoIP.ms (see docs/pstn-calling-voipms-plan.md for the design/
# cost background this is built from) but isn't hardcoded to it — any SIP
# trunk provider that supports IP authentication works the same way.
#
# Requires an existing services/asterisk-digital-ocean.sh install — this adds
# a PSTN trunk on top of it and does not stand alone.
#
# Part of the modular post-install system (sourced by setup.sh).
register_service pstn-trunk homelab "SIP PSTN trunk for asterisk-digital-ocean — US-only, role-based permissions, spend/volume alerts (defaults to VoIP.ms)"
# ── Surviving Easy Asterisk's regeneration ──────────────────────────────────
# Easy Asterisk (the vendor project asterisk-digital-ocean.sh builds on) fully
# OVERWRITES both pjsip.conf and extensions.conf from its own internal state:
# - extensions.conf: rebuilt by rebuild_dialplan() on every container start,
# and whenever a device/room is added or removed via the web admin.
# - pjsip.conf: rewritten by generate_pjsip_conf() whenever VLAN/domain/TLS
# settings are changed via the CLI menu (docker exec ... easy-asterisk).
# It restores only its own "; === Device:"-marked sections from backup —
# a hand-appended trunk section would be silently wiped the next time
# that runs.
# So the trunk/dialplan content below lives in its own files and is
# #include'd from the generated files instead of appended directly. To make
# the #include itself survive regeneration too, _pstn_patch_vendor_files
# (below) patches it into the vendor's *generator functions* — the same
# technique this repo already uses for the logger.conf security-logging fix
# in _asterisk_do_refresh_vendor_files (see services/asterisk-digital-ocean.sh).
#
# Caveat: if the base asterisk-digital-ocean install is later refreshed
# ("update in place", which re-copies fresh vendor files) independently of
# this service, the patch is wiped along with it and needs reapplying — run
# this service again (fresh or update mode both reapply it) after any
# asterisk-digital-ocean update.
# ── Shared: patch vendor generator functions to #include our config ────────
# Anchors on "user_agent=EasyAsterisk" (pjsip.conf's [global] section) and
# "[intercom]" (extensions.conf) — each confirmed to appear exactly once per
# file in the vendor source, so this is safe regardless of what else changes
# around it upstream. Idempotent: skips files that already have the include.
_pstn_patch_vendor_files() {
local EA_DIR="$1"
local ENTRYPOINT="$EA_DIR/docker/entrypoint.sh"
local EASY1="$EA_DIR/easy-asterisk.sh"
local EASY2="$EA_DIR/easy-asterisk-v0.10.0.sh"
local f
for f in "$ENTRYPOINT" "$EASY1" "$EASY2"; do
[[ -f "$f" ]] || { log_error "$f not found — is asterisk-digital-ocean fully installed?"; return 1; }
done
for f in "$ENTRYPOINT" "$EASY1" "$EASY2"; do
if ! grep -q 'pstn-trunk-pjsip.conf' "$f"; then
if grep -q '^user_agent=EasyAsterisk$' "$f"; then
sed -i '/^user_agent=EasyAsterisk$/a #include pstn-trunk-pjsip.conf' "$f"
else
log_warning "$(basename "$f"): 'user_agent=EasyAsterisk' anchor not found — vendor template changed upstream."
log_warning " Add '#include pstn-trunk-pjsip.conf' manually after [global] in this file's pjsip.conf heredoc."
fi
fi
done
for f in "$ENTRYPOINT" "$EASY1" "$EASY2"; do
if ! grep -q 'pstn-trunk-dialplan.conf' "$f"; then
if grep -q '^\[intercom\]$' "$f"; then
sed -i '/^\[intercom\]$/a #include pstn-trunk-dialplan.conf' "$f"
else
log_warning "$(basename "$f"): '[intercom]' anchor not found — vendor template changed upstream."
log_warning " Add '#include pstn-trunk-dialplan.conf' manually after [intercom] in this file's extensions.conf heredoc."
fi
fi
done
log_success "Vendor generator functions patched to include the PSTN trunk config."
}
# ── Shared: pjsip trunk config (aor/identify/endpoint, IP-authenticated) ───
_pstn_write_pjsip_include() {
local FILE="$1" SERVER="$2" SERVER_IP="$3" DID="$4"
cat > "$FILE" << 'EOF'
; SIP PSTN trunk — IP authentication, no password stored (see
; docs/pstn-calling-voipms-plan.md). Regenerated by services/pstn-trunk.sh —
; edit there, not here directly, or a reinstall/update will overwrite this.
;
; match= below is the resolved IP of the server hostname at install time.
; Providers sometimes send inbound INVITEs from a different IP than the one
; their hostname resolves to (load balancing / multiple servers per POP) —
; if inbound calls stop matching after a provider-side change, re-run this
; service to re-resolve and rewrite it, or add extra "type=identify" /
; "match=" lines here by hand for additional known source IPs.
[pstn-trunk]
type=aor
contact=sip:__PSTN_SERVER__
qualify_frequency=60
[pstn-trunk]
type=identify
endpoint=pstn-trunk
match=__PSTN_SERVER_IP__
[pstn-trunk]
type=endpoint
context=from-pstn-trunk
disallow=all
allow=ulaw,alaw
aors=pstn-trunk
from_user=__PSTN_DID__
from_domain=__PSTN_SERVER__
callerid=__PSTN_DID__
direct_media=no
EOF
sed -i "s/__PSTN_SERVER_IP__/${SERVER_IP}/g; s/__PSTN_SERVER__/${SERVER}/g; s/__PSTN_DID__/${DID}/g" "$FILE"
}
# ── Shared: outbound/inbound dialplan ───────────────────────────────────────
# Continues in the [intercom] context established just above this include
# (rebuild_dialplan() writes "[intercom]" then this #include right after it),
# so existing extensions can dial out through it directly. [from-pstn-trunk]
# below is a separate context, for calls arriving from the trunk.
#
# Role model: internal intercom dialing (extension-to-extension) is NEVER
# gated here — everyone keeps that, regardless of PSTN permission. Only the
# two NANP patterns (the trunk route) are gated by ALLOWED_REGEX. An empty
# allow-list at install time becomes ".*" (match anything), preserving
# "every extension can dial out" as the explicit opt-in default.
#
# Calls are logged to pstn-trunk-calls.log (epoch|direction|who|what|seconds)
# for the usage-alert script — not Asterisk's own CDR, to avoid depending on
# whether cdr_csv is enabled/configured on a given image, and to sidestep
# CDR CSV's comma-quoting entirely (our own pipe-delimited format has no
# embedded-delimiter risk since every field here is digits/hostnames).
_pstn_write_dialplan_include() {
local FILE="$1" DID="$2" ALLOWED_REGEX="$3" MAX_CONCURRENT="$4" RING_DIAL="$5" NTFY_URL="$6"
cat > "$FILE" << 'EOF'
; PSTN outbound/inbound — US-only (NANP), concurrent-call cap, role-based
; outbound permission. Regenerated by services/pstn-trunk.sh — edit there,
; not here directly, or a reinstall/update will overwrite this.
;
; No catch-all pattern here on purpose: only these two NANP patterns route
; to the trunk, so an unauthorized or compromised extension can't reach
; anything else even if the trunk itself would technically allow more. See
; docs/pstn-calling-voipms-plan.md for the toll-fraud reasoning.
exten => _1NXXNXXXXX,1,NoOp(PSTN outbound call attempt from ${CHANNEL(peername)} to ${EXTEN})
same => n,Set(PSTN_CALLER=${CHANNEL(peername)})
same => n,GotoIf($[${REGEX("^(__PSTN_ALLOWED_REGEX__)$" ${PSTN_CALLER})} = 1]?pstn_check_busy,1)
same => n,NoOp(Denied - ${PSTN_CALLER} is not authorized for PSTN outbound)
__ALERT_DENY_LINE__
same => n,Busy(15)
same => n,Hangup()
exten => _NXXNXXXXX,1,NoOp(Assuming NANP - adding leading 1)
same => n,Goto(1${EXTEN},1)
exten => pstn_check_busy,1,GotoIf($[${GROUP_COUNT(pstn-out)} >= __PSTN_MAX_CONCURRENT__]?pstn_busy,1)
same => n,Set(GROUP()=pstn-out)
same => n,Set(CALLERID(num)=__PSTN_DID__)
same => n,Set(PSTN_START=${EPOCH})
same => n,Dial(PJSIP/${EXTEN}@pstn-trunk,60)
same => n,Set(PSTN_DUR=$[${EPOCH} - ${PSTN_START}])
same => n,System(printf '%s|out|%s|%s|%s\n' "${PSTN_START}" "${PSTN_CALLER}" "${EXTEN}" "${PSTN_DUR}" >> /var/log/asterisk/pstn-trunk-calls.log)
same => n,Hangup()
exten => pstn_busy,1,NoOp(PSTN trunk - concurrent-call cap reached, rejecting)
__ALERT_BUSY_LINE__
same => n,Busy(15)
same => n,Hangup()
[from-pstn-trunk]
exten => _X.,1,NoOp(Inbound PSTN call from ${CALLERID(num)})
same => n,Set(PSTN_START=${EPOCH})
same => n,Dial(__PSTN_RING_DIAL__,20)
same => n,Set(PSTN_DUR=$[${EPOCH} - ${PSTN_START}])
same => n,System(printf '%s|in|%s|ring-group|%s\n' "${PSTN_START}" "${CALLERID(num)}" "${PSTN_DUR}" >> /var/log/asterisk/pstn-trunk-calls.log)
same => n,Hangup()
EOF
sed -i "s/__PSTN_ALLOWED_REGEX__/${ALLOWED_REGEX}/g; s/__PSTN_MAX_CONCURRENT__/${MAX_CONCURRENT}/g; s/__PSTN_DID__/${DID}/g" "$FILE"
# RING_DIAL is "PJSIP/a&PJSIP/b&..." — the literal "&" must be escaped in
# a sed replacement (bare "&" means "the matched text", same gotcha as
# NTFY_URL below), or every "&" gets replaced with the placeholder itself.
local _esc_ring_dial="${RING_DIAL//&/\\&}"
sed -i "s#__PSTN_RING_DIAL__#${_esc_ring_dial}#g" "$FILE"
if [[ -n "$NTFY_URL" ]]; then
local _esc_url="${NTFY_URL//&/\\&}"
sed -i "s#__ALERT_DENY_LINE__# same => n,System(curl -m 5 -s -d 'PSTN trunk: outbound call denied - extension not authorized.' '${_esc_url}' >/dev/null 2>\\&1 \\&)#" "$FILE"
sed -i "s#__ALERT_BUSY_LINE__# same => n,System(curl -m 5 -s -d 'PSTN trunk: concurrent-call cap reached - a call was rejected.' '${_esc_url}' >/dev/null 2>\\&1 \\&)#" "$FILE"
else
sed -i "/__ALERT_DENY_LINE__/d; /__ALERT_BUSY_LINE__/d" "$FILE"
fi
}
# ── Shared: periodic spend/volume checker (run hourly via cron) ────────────
_pstn_write_usage_alert_script() {
local FILE="$1" EA_DIR="$2" RATE="$3" MONTH_THRESHOLD="$4" BURST_THRESHOLD="$5" NTFY_URL="$6"
cat > "$FILE" << 'EOF'
#!/bin/bash
# Auto-generated by services/pstn-trunk.sh — do not edit directly, re-run
# the installer instead. Run hourly via /etc/cron.d/pstn-trunk-usage.
# Reads the call log pstn-trunk-dialplan.conf appends to and alerts via
# ntfy when month-to-date estimated spend crosses a threshold (alerted once
# per month) or when call volume in the last hour looks like a burst.
LOG_FILE="__EA_DIR__/logs/pstn-trunk-calls.log"
STATE_FILE="__EA_DIR__/.pstn-trunk-alert-state"
RATE="__PSTN_RATE__"
MONTH_THRESHOLD="__PSTN_MONTH_THRESHOLD__"
BURST_THRESHOLD="__PSTN_BURST_THRESHOLD__"
NTFY_URL="__PSTN_NTFY_URL__"
[[ -f "$LOG_FILE" ]] || exit 0
now_epoch=$(date +%s)
current_month=$(date +%Y-%m)
one_hour_ago=$((now_epoch - 3600))
month_start_epoch=$(date -d "$(date +%Y-%m-01)" +%s)
month_seconds=$(awk -F'|' -v start="$month_start_epoch" '$2=="out" && $1+0>=start {sum+=$5} END{print sum+0}' "$LOG_FILE")
month_minutes=$(awk -v s="$month_seconds" 'BEGIN{printf "%.1f", s/60}')
month_cost=$(awk -v m="$month_minutes" -v r="$RATE" 'BEGIN{printf "%.2f", m*r}')
hour_calls=$(awk -F'|' -v start="$one_hour_ago" '$2=="out" && $1+0>=start {c++} END{print c+0}' "$LOG_FILE")
send_ntfy() {
[[ -n "$NTFY_URL" ]] && curl -m 5 -s -d "$1" "$NTFY_URL" >/dev/null 2>&1
}
last_alert_month=""
[[ -f "$STATE_FILE" ]] && last_alert_month=$(cat "$STATE_FILE")
if awk -v c="$month_cost" -v t="$MONTH_THRESHOLD" 'BEGIN{exit !(c>=t)}'; then
if [[ "$last_alert_month" != "$current_month" ]]; then
send_ntfy "PSTN trunk: estimated spend this month (\$${month_cost}) has crossed the \$${MONTH_THRESHOLD} threshold. ${month_minutes} minutes so far."
echo "$current_month" > "$STATE_FILE"
fi
fi
if [[ "$hour_calls" -ge "$BURST_THRESHOLD" ]]; then
send_ntfy "PSTN trunk: $hour_calls outbound calls placed in the last hour - check for unusual activity."
fi
EOF
sed -i "s#__EA_DIR__#${EA_DIR}#g; s/__PSTN_RATE__/${RATE}/g; s/__PSTN_MONTH_THRESHOLD__/${MONTH_THRESHOLD}/g; s/__PSTN_BURST_THRESHOLD__/${BURST_THRESHOLD}/g" "$FILE"
sed -i "s#__PSTN_NTFY_URL__#${NTFY_URL}#g" "$FILE"
chmod 755 "$FILE"
}

## Role model
Every extension can always call and receive calls from other Asterisk
extensions — that's unchanged and never gated. The PSTN-allowed list above
only controls the two additional things a "PSTN-enabled" extension gets on
top of that: dialing real phone numbers out, and being included in the
inbound ring-group. Leaving the allow-list blank means every extension gets
PSTN access too (the original default before roles existed).
## How this survives Easy Asterisk's own regeneration
Easy Asterisk rewrites \`pjsip.conf\` and \`extensions.conf\` from its own
internal state (device list, network settings) rather than treating them as
hand-edited files. Trunk/dialplan config here lives in two files of its own,
\`#include\`'d from the generated files:
- \`config/asterisk/pstn-trunk-pjsip.conf\` — the trunk's \`aor\`/\`identify\`/
\`endpoint\` sections (IP-authenticated, no password stored).
- \`config/asterisk/pstn-trunk-dialplan.conf\` — NANP-only outbound routing,
the outbound permission gate, the concurrency cap, ntfy alert hooks, and
the \`[from-pstn-trunk]\` inbound context.
The \`#include\` lines themselves are patched into Easy Asterisk's *generator
functions* (\`docker/entrypoint.sh\`, \`easy-asterisk.sh\`,
\`easy-asterisk-v0.10.0.sh\`) so they get re-emitted every time those functions
regenerate the config, instead of being wiped.
**Caveat:** if the base \`asterisk-digital-ocean\` service is ever updated
independently (\`sudo ./setup.sh asterisk-digital-ocean\`, choosing "update in
place" — that path re-copies fresh vendor files), this patch is wiped along
with it. Re-run \`sudo ./setup.sh pstn-trunk\` afterward (update mode
reapplies the patch and rewrites everything from \`.pstn-trunk.env\`, no
re-prompting).
## Spend/volume alerts
\`pstn-trunk-usage-alert.sh\` runs hourly (\`/etc/cron.d/pstn-trunk-usage\`) and
reads \`logs/pstn-trunk-calls.log\` (appended to directly by the dialplan, not
Asterisk's own CDR — a deliberate choice to avoid depending on whether this
image's CDR modules are enabled/configured, and to sidestep CDR CSV's
comma-quoting). It sends an ntfy alert:
- **Once per calendar month** the first time estimated spend crosses
\$${MONTH_THRESHOLD} (state tracked in \`.pstn-trunk-alert-state\` so it
doesn't repeat every hour).
- **Every hour** that outbound call volume exceeds ${BURST_THRESHOLD}
calls/hour — this is the faster tripwire for a burst/abuse scenario,
independent of whether it's crossed the monthly dollar threshold yet.
Separately, denied calls (unauthorized extension) and rejected calls
(concurrency cap hit) alert **immediately**, not on the hourly schedule —
see the dialplan file's \`__ALERT_DENY_LINE__\`/\`__ALERT_BUSY_LINE__\` sites.
These are cost *estimates* (call count/duration × your entered rate), not
real billing data — treat them as a safety net, not a substitute for
checking your provider's own balance/usage dashboard.
